Where does yesterday exist right now?追加:
Yesterday does not exist anywhere in the physical universe. Yet human beings carry its heavy invisible corpse into every single room they enter. If a traveler wished to journey to the previous year, no vessel could map the coordinates because history has no atomic structure outside current neural firing. The ordinary individual moves through life under a profound optical illusion, treating memory as a static filing cabinet or a stone monument set in rock. But neuroscience and metaphysics reveal a radical truth.
Remembering is not retrieval. It is active realtime production. When an individual recalls a past rejection or a devastating failure, the brain does not visit a cosmic archive. It uses its current emotional state as a biased filter to actively film, edit, and score a brand new mental movie in the present tense. Carrying the state of a rejected person subtly alters the micro expressions of the face, the cadence of the stride, and the invisible frequencies broadcasted to others, forcing the external mirror of the world to continuously remanifest the old limitation. The epiphany is total. The past is not a solid prison. It is a fluid line of code running in the current imagination. And because it only lives now, it can be retroactively rewritten.
